What is an ISO Training Course?
An ISO training course is a structured learning program designed to explain the requirements and practical application of standards such as 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 27001, ISO 45001, ISO 13485, and ISO 22000. Participants learn how to implement management systems, interpret standard requirements, manage documented information, conduct internal audits, identify risks and opportunities, and implement corrective actions that improve organizational performance.
Key Topics Covered
An ISO training course covers management system principles, standard interpretation, process-based thinking, risk management, documentation control, internal auditing, performance evaluation, corrective actions, compliance requirements, management reviews, and continual improvement. Training programs often include practical exercises, case studies, workshops, and real-world examples to help participants apply their knowledge effectively in the workplace.

Continual Improvement
Continual improvement is a core principle of every ISO management system. Organizations should regularly evaluate performance, conduct internal audits, monitor objectives, implement corrective actions, and update their management systems to respond to changing business needs, regulatory requirements, and industry developments.
